Giants dominate Pirates 8-1 as Webb strikes out 10 in six innings
PITTSBURGH — Logan Webb delivered a commanding performance, recording 10 strikeouts over six innings, as the San Francisco Giants secured an 8-1 victory against the Pittsburgh Pirates on Tuesday night. Webb (10-8) allowed just one run while scattering seven hits. This marked his sixth game this season with double-digit strikeouts. Offensively, rookie Christian Koss and Willy Adames each launched two-run home runs, while Jerar Encarnacion added a solo shot off rookie pitcher Mike Burrows. The Giants' win marked only their third victory in their last 11 games. Koss opened the scoring with a homer to the left-field bleachers in the third inning. Encarnacion's blast increased the lead to 3-1 in the fourth, and Adames' 18th homer of the year made it 6-1 in the fifth. Encarnacion returned to action after missing nearly three months due to a strained left oblique. San Francisco also received a two-run single from Patrick Bailey in the sixth inning. Burrows (1-4) was charged with six runs over 4 2/3 innings. For Pittsburgh, Bryan Reynolds contributed two hits and drove in the Pirates' only run with a single in the third.
